ELF method (IS 1893): assumes the building responds in its fundamental mode (valid for regular, short buildings — T < 0.4 s). Design base shear Vb = Ah × W (Ah = design horizontal coefficient, W = seismic weight = DL + 50% LL). Distribution: Fi = Vb × Wi×hi² / Σ(Wj×hj²) (parabolic for first mode). For irregular or tall buildings (T > 0.4 s): dynamic analysis (response spectrum) required.
